0x300e0e904cd85eb40d55bdd079518845df601192

Verified contract

Proxy

Active on Base with 195 txns
Deployed by via 0x4711ced3 at 2583812
Slot
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0
-
variable spans 49 additional slots

No balances found for "0x300e0e904cd85eb40d55bdd079518845df601192"

0x5d311501b5e49b581d189fcd5dcf9264ebb1bad8216a8ccb2a44f109c92770e6
0xf511ce95b464bb7910b72aa7ace07dae86247b160922afe26e2c3361ce9de909
0x598688ef7be42104332e2e819ffc3319a61d8eb086b7814f34dec4d044392a07
0xdf474ef35d43c719361cbad95d2c790a1cf78cea3e85e79c85de850c849c4693
0x35d39d2c3a1ecfdc492a5ce35c3b7853cd12f7a34e2de4a5773aac023cce84e3
0x9e7cb3583fa28a2ea02a37f89f6fc79f40a16c9c3650f8124ac518045d47cfb5
0x9502832e87ea27547ac951f1326e7799621ced2be6c1485360d01f3bc410ee7c
0x645ff256c4aead84ea496fb3959a02b31e493bea21973d9ba7682b235c8b946b
0x5df2d67709dc97245ce75ae560b44d54e11fad6c33f5c78fa8a7e1045b5850d9
0xa6d598b874cef5819bc49dcc56ab2d7a9d96d48ce062524a6e00bc92f2af3a4f

Functions
Getter at block 23161775
EMISSION_MANAGER(view returns (address)
0x65e1344d17cc080ac77fb03b49cf5d0caf7bfeb8
REVISION(view returns (uint256)
1
getEmissionManager(view returns (address)
0x65e1344d17cc080ac77fb03b49cf5d0caf7bfeb8
getRewardsList(view returns (address[])
[0x4200000000000000000000000000000000000006, 0x4F8B9A7f80b3C3FbB00517086A55133073F90558]
Read-only
getAllUserRewards(address[] assetsaddress userview returns (address[] rewardsListuint256[] unclaimedAmounts)
getAssetDecimals(address assetview returns (uint8)
getAssetIndex(address assetaddress rewardview returns (uint256uint256)
getClaimer(address userview returns (address)
getDistributionEnd(address assetaddress rewardview returns (uint256)
getRewardOracle(address rewardview returns (address)
getRewardsByAsset(address assetview returns (address[])
getRewardsData(address assetaddress rewardview returns (uint256uint256uint256uint256)
getTransferStrategy(address rewardview returns (address)
getUserAccruedRewards(address useraddress rewardview returns (uint256)
getUserAssetIndex(address useraddress assetaddress rewardview returns (uint256)
getUserRewards(address[] assetsaddress useraddress rewardview returns (uint256)
State-modifying
claimAllRewards(address[] assetsaddress toreturns (address[] rewardsListuint256[] claimedAmounts)
claimAllRewardsOnBehalf(address[] assetsaddress useraddress toreturns (address[] rewardsListuint256[] claimedAmounts)
claimAllRewardsToSelf(address[] assetsreturns (address[] rewardsListuint256[] claimedAmounts)
claimRewards(address[] assetsuint256 amountaddress toaddress rewardreturns (uint256)
claimRewardsOnBehalf(address[] assetsuint256 amountaddress useraddress toaddress rewardreturns (uint256)
claimRewardsToSelf(address[] assetsuint256 amountaddress rewardreturns (uint256)
configureAssets(struct RewardsDataTypesRewardsConfigInput[] config
handleAction(address useruint256 totalSupplyuint256 userBalance
initialize(address
setClaimer(address useraddress caller
setDistributionEnd(address assetaddress rewarduint32 newDistributionEnd
setEmissionPerSecond(address assetaddress[] rewardsuint88[] newEmissionsPerSecond
setRewardOracle(address rewardaddress rewardOracle
setTransferStrategy(address rewardaddress transferStrategy
Events
Accrued(address indexed assetaddress indexed rewardaddress indexed useruint256 assetIndexuint256 userIndexuint256 rewardsAccrued
AssetConfigUpdated(address indexed assetaddress indexed rewarduint256 oldEmissionuint256 newEmissionuint256 oldDistributionEnduint256 newDistributionEnduint256 assetIndex
ClaimerSet(address indexed useraddress indexed claimer
RewardOracleUpdated(address indexed rewardaddress indexed rewardOracle
RewardsClaimed(address indexed useraddress indexed rewardaddress indexed toaddress claimeruint256 amount
TransferStrategyInstalled(address indexed rewardaddress indexed transferStrategy
Constructor

This contract contains no constructor objects.

Fallback and receive

This contract contains no fallback and receive objects.

Errors

This contract contains no error objects.